Re: fcitx: add usage with kitty & fix typo

On 22/06/08 09:56AM, Omar Polo wrote:
> Yifei Zhan <openbsd@zhan.science> wrote:
> > This is a README update:
> >
> > - kitty needs an extra variable to work with fcitx
> > - fix my typo, fcitx-config-qt should be fcitx-configtool-qt
> >

> > +To use fcitx with kitty terminal, also add the following line:
> > +
> > +export GLFW_IM_MODULE=ibus
>
> I guess this is not needed only for kitty, but also for other
> applications using GLFW?

I'm not sure, I can't validate as I'm not aware of any other
application requiring this variable despite some grepping in the ports
tree/searching on the web. However, if that's the case, I'm not
against changing it :)

>
> if so I'd add it in the previous block along with the XMODIFIERS,
> GTK_IM_MODULE and qt module.
